Career and Affiliations
Anita Sidén worked as a politician[3]. Positions held include member of the Swedish Riksdag[7], a member of the parliament of Sweden[26], in Sweden[27], founded in 1971[28]; Member of the Committee on Justice[10]; Member of the Committee on Social Insurance[11]; and rector[12], an elective office[29].
Personal Life
Anita Sidén was affiliated with the Moderate Party[15].
